Overview

Postcode TN14 6BW is located in a rural hamlet, within the Brasted, Chevening and Sundridge ward of Sevenoaks in the South East region, and forms part of the Sevenoaks West & Chevening area. It has moderate de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 50.2 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Sevenoaks West & Chevening is £89,100 per year. The nearest station is Sevenoaks located about 2.1 miles away.

Property prices in Brasted, Chevening and Sundridge

Based on 64 recent sales, the median property price is £726,250 in Brasted, Chevening and Sundridge area, with individual transactions ranging from £173,000 up to £3,350,000.
